Chelsea Women emerged winners of the 2023/24 Women’s Super League on the final day after putting Manchester United Women to a rout.

The Emma Hayes-led side steamrollered to a thumping 6-0 victory at Old Trafford to win their record-extending 7th Women’s Super League title.

Since 2020, the London-based side have dominated the England women’s topflight elite division but the 2023/24 title went down to the wires.

Runners-up, Manchester City Women, staged a formidable challenge and were stuck on the same points (52) ahead of the final matchday.

However, Chelsea led the race on goal difference, two better than the reckoners. Heading into the final matchday, it was certainly going down to goal margins between the two sides to determine the winner.

Manchester City won 2-1 away against Aston Villa in the other fixture to secure all 3 points but the score margin wasn’t enough to break Chelsea’s enduring dominance of the WSL.

At Old Trafford, Chelsea Women secured one of their biggest wins this season, pummeling Manchester United Women to submission with a 6-0 victory.

The 2024 UEFA Women’s Champions League semifinalists got off the mark from the first half, scoring four before the break through Ramirez’s brace, and Kaneryd and Nusken’s goals.

In the second half, Leupolz and Kirby extended the score margin to inflict United Women with their biggest defeat this season in front of the home fans.

The 6-0 victory saw Chelsea extend their goal advantage over Manchester City to seven goals, enough to see them rake home their seventh Women’s Super League title.

It was a celebration galore for the players and Emma Hayes, who took to the pitch to celebrate another big milestone for the club.

The Blues have now won the Women’s Super League Title in five consecutive seasons, becoming the first club to do.
